This is a picture of an Indian traditional wedding sari, which showcases the charm and uniqueness of Indian culture.
The sari is a traditional attire worn by Indian women during weddings, made of silk with vibrant colors and intricate patterns.
Red symbolizes joy and passion, while gold represents wealth and glory.
The design and creation of this sari require exquisite skills and patience, making each piece a one-of-a-kind work of art.
Women wearing this sari exude an enchanting allure that captivates people's attention.
It is not just a piece of clothing but also a symbol and inheritance of culture.
By appreciating and learning about the design and creation of this sari, we can better understand the history and development of Indian culture.
